AI-Driven Scams: A Growing Threat

As artificial intelligence (AI) technology advances, it is reshaping various sectors, particularly cybersecurity. The emergence of generative AI tools has attracted the attention of cybercriminals, enabling them to launch increasingly sophisticated scams. The use of AI in crafting hyper-realistic phishing emails and deepfakes has surged, leading to a significant increase in cyberattacks. These developments pose serious threats to individuals and organizations, making it crucial to understand their implications.

The speed and efficiency with which AI can generate convincing fraudulent content have rendered traditional security measures less effective. Previously, phishing attacks relied on poorly written emails that were easy to spot. Now, AI-driven scams can mimic the writing style of trusted contacts, complicating the ability of recipients to discern the truth. Organizations are struggling to cope with the volume and complexity of these attacks, as highlighted by Rhiannon Williams in her analysis of the current cybercrime landscape.

AI’s Impact on Healthcare Innovation

AI’s influence extends beyond cybercrime into healthcare, where it serves as both a tool for innovation and a potential source of concern. AI technologies are being utilized to assist healthcare professionals in various capacities, from analyzing patient data to improving diagnostic accuracy. These advancements promise to enhance patient care and streamline operations within healthcare systems.

However, the integration of AI in healthcare raises critical questions about its effectiveness. While many AI-driven tools show promise in accurately interpreting medical data, there is ongoing debate about whether their use translates into better health outcomes for patients. Jessica Hamzelou notes that despite the growing adoption of AI in clinical settings, the evidence supporting its impact on patient health remains inconclusive.

Regulatory Challenges in AI Deployment

The global landscape of AI technology is complex and varies significantly from one region to another. In the United States and Europe, regulatory frameworks are evolving to address the challenges posed by AI in both cybersecurity and healthcare. Governments are beginning to recognize the need for policies that protect consumers while fostering innovation. For instance, the European Union has proposed regulations aimed at ensuring AI technologies are safe and ethical.

Conversely, countries with less stringent regulations may face different challenges. In regions where cybersecurity laws are underdeveloped, the proliferation of AI-driven scams can escalate rapidly. This disparity in regulatory approaches can create a patchwork of protections, leaving some populations more vulnerable to the risks associated with AI misuse.

Future Directions: Innovation and Accountability

The future of AI in both cybersecurity and healthcare is likely to be characterized by increased scrutiny and regulation. As the risks associated with AI technologies become more apparent, stakeholders will demand greater transparency and accountability. This shift may lead to the development of more robust standards for evaluating AI tools, ensuring they meet safety and effectiveness criteria before widespread adoption.

In cybersecurity, organizations will need to adapt to an ever-evolving threat landscape. As AI continues to empower cybercriminals, businesses must invest in advanced security measures that leverage AI’s capabilities to detect and mitigate threats. This proactive approach will be essential for safeguarding sensitive information and maintaining trust with customers.
